The general counsel for Florida ’s Department of Health, John Wilson, resigned earlier this month — and new court records show it was because he was uncomfortable sending threats on behalf of Gov. Ron DeSantis to TV stations for airing pro-choice political advertisements.

Wilson hinted when he resigned that the threats to TV stations were part of his decision. “A man is nothing without his conscience.
